Diabolic Servitude, designated as card number 130s, is an uncommon black enchantment from the Urza's Saga set released by Magic: The Gathering in 1998. This card is a notable addition for collectors of vintage trading cards who appreciate the strategic depth and distinctive design elements of the late 1990s era. The card's intricate mechanics offer a compelling gameplay experience that has maintained interest among enthusiasts of the Magic: The Gathering trading card game. Illustrated by Scott M. Fischer, Diabolic Servitude features a mana cost of {3}{B} and a mana value of 4. As an enchantment, it provides a unique strategic advantage by allowing players to return a target creature card from their graveyard to the battlefield when it enters. This recursive ability is central to the card's identity, creating a dynamic interaction that continues to evolve as the creature on the battlefield dies or the enchantment itself leaves play. Card Text
Abilities, attacks, oracle text, and flavor text printed on the card.
When this enchantment enters, return target creature card from your graveyard to the battlefield. When the creature put onto the battlefield with this enchantment dies, exile it and return this enchantment to its owner's hand. When this enchantment leaves the battlefield, exile the creature put onto the battlefield with this enchantment.
